The high tide height is shown as a positive number, sometimes with + before it, indicating the height of high tide above the chart datum. So to find the water level at high tide, add the high tide level to the chart datum. Low Tide. The low tide figure can be positive or negative.

Spring tides are especially strong tides (they do not have anything to do with the season Spring). They occur when the Earth, the Sun, and the Moon are in a line. The gravitational forces of the Moon and the Sun both contribute to the tides. Spring tides occur during the full moon and the new moon.
